<em>Steve Keenan, online travel editor from the London Sunday Times summarizes Valencia&#8217;s unique approach to a media/blogging fam</em></p>
<p><strong>Valencia Leads</strong></p>
<p>A few weeks ago the <a href="http://en.comunitatvalenciana.com/home/home-english/493"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/en.comunitatvalenciana.com/home/home-english/493?referer=');">Valencia Tourism Region</a> hosted a blog trip (#blogtripF1) and it could very well be the new standard for DMOs to model their traditional media trips or media fams after. I was fortunate enough to be invited on the trip.</p>
<p>Valencia Tourism invited a mix of traditional journalist, travel bloggers, social media travel, web technology and web design professionals. These people of all ages, with diverse skill-sets and interests where hosted on a four day event centred around Valencia and the Formula One Grand Prix.</p>
<p>It included all the hallmarks of a traditional media trip. Visits to the best restaurants, the top sights, attractions and accommodations. The trip included private guides and behind the scenes tours, all well organized as you can expect from any respectable DMO.</p>
<p><img class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-1888" title="valencia" src="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/wp-content/uploads/valencia-450x215.png" alt="" width="450" height="215" /></p>
<p><strong>Making the media trip social</strong><br />
Valencia Tourism innovated the traditional trip by creating a place for these professionals to collaborate, discuss, debate and most of all develop new relationships. Social Media professionals are social by definition and unlike traditional journalists who are more driven by exclusivity, bloggers understand their individual success is strengthened by the success of their relationships and their network.</p>
<p><strong>Taking advantage of educational opportunities</strong><br />
The place to kick-off the discussion was at a conference where attendees presented a topic related to their area of expertise (<a href="http://www.livestream.com/promoturismo/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.livestream.com/promoturismo/?referer=');">videos of presentations here</a>). The event was attended by many local, national DMO&#8217;s and operators. A great way to get Tourism Valencia&#8217;s stakeholders access to the knowledge in the group.</p>
<p><strong>Fostering the creation of networks</strong><br />
Over the next few days we got to know each other very well. There was enough time and opportunity to do so. We discussed and debated all topics digital travel professionals are interested in. And everything was tweeted in real time of course, creating a surge of Valencia exposure in real time, across many people&#8217;s personal and professional networks.</p>
<p><img class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-1896" title="Screen shot 2011-08-30 at 9.12.57 AM" src="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/wp-content/uploads/Screen-shot-2011-08-30-at-9.12.57-AM-450x258.png" alt="" width="450" height="258" /></p>
<p><strong>Creating remarkable experiences</strong><br />
Remarkable experiences turn into social objects, shared in social media. These are the things worth blogging, tweeting and Facebooking about. There were plenty in Valencia. Walking on top of a shark tank, <a href="http://blog.brillianttrips.com/2011/07/the-world%E2%80%99s-best-paella-in-valencia/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/blog.brillianttrips.com/2011/07/the-world_E2_80_99s-best-paella-in-valencia/?referer=');">eating the best Paella</a>, incredibly photogenic <a href="http://www.ottsworld.com/blogs/numbers-into-beauty-valencia/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.ottsworld.com/blogs/numbers-into-beauty-valencia/?referer=');">modern architecture</a>, <a href="http://anniebennettspain.com/2011/06/22/a-quiet-hour-in-the-bar-pilar-in-valencia/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/anniebennettspain.com/2011/06/22/a-quiet-hour-in-the-bar-pilar-in-valencia/?referer=');">random bars</a>, <a href="http://collazoprojects.com/2011/07/02/valencia-spain-in-4-plates/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/collazoprojects.com/2011/07/02/valencia-spain-in-4-plates/?referer=');">more great food</a> and of course <a href="http://www.ottsworld.com/blogs/photo-of-the-week-speed-in-valencia/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.ottsworld.com/blogs/photo-of-the-week-speed-in-valencia/?referer=');">the F1 race</a>.</p>
<p>Remarkable experiences was also the subject of my presentation, summarized in this interview<br />
<iframe src="http://www.youtube.com/embed/CXLUEgRDqrk" frameborder="0" width="450" height="253"></iframe></p>
<p><strong>Build in surprises</strong><br />
Exclusive access, or including things money can&#8217;t buy will generate even more conversations. The trip offered personalized surprises such as a <a href="http://blog.brillianttrips.com/2011/06/a-trip-through-a-formula-1-paddock-in-valencia/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/blog.brillianttrips.com/2011/06/a-trip-through-a-formula-1-paddock-in-valencia/?referer=');">visit to the F1 paddock</a>, a<a href="http://www.insidethetravellab.com/the-valencia-grand-prix-inside-the-safety-car/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.insidethetravellab.com/the-valencia-grand-prix-inside-the-safety-car/?referer=');"> ride down the track in the safety car</a> and even a <a href="http://www.foxnomad.com/2011/07/12/experiencing-formula-1-in-valencia-spain-at-300-kilometers-per-hour/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.foxnomad.com/2011/07/12/experiencing-formula-1-in-valencia-spain-at-300-kilometers-per-hour/?referer=');">drive in a converted 3-seater Formula One car</a> for some.</p>
<p><strong>Results</strong><br />
The tally so far? By the last count I&#8217;ve heard a while back a few dozen blog posts have been written, 61 YouTube videos created, 363 people tweeted 1,558 tweets reaching over 2 million people all around the world while articles in traditional media are being written.</p>
<p>But the real value is not just the immediate exposure but the fact that Valencia sits at the centre of a strong network of travel bloggers and tourism professionals including their expended networks. Valencia will always be top op mind when I connect with any of the new friends I&#8217;ve made.</p>
<p>Promoting by focussing on building networks and putting yourself in the middle of it. That&#8217;s the future. Valencia has re-invented itself over the last years with new tourism attractions, infrastructure and mega-events. They&#8217;re doing the same with destination marketing. </p>

<p>I often hear from hotel operators that negative reviews on Tripadvisor usually aren&#8217;t from their typical customers. A 4-star hotel receives bad reviews from customers who got a deal on a discount website because of high parking fees and the expensive restaurant. A family oriented hotel receives bad reviews from business traveler who complain about the noise from the kids playing in the pool.</p>
<p>I use the chart below in some of my presentations:</p>
<p><img class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-1745" title="Meh" src="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/wp-content/uploads/Slide21-450x337.jpg" alt="" width="450" height="337" /></p>
</div>
<p>There are a lot of people will love your product and a lot of people who probably won&#8217;t. The people who love of hate your product are the people who will talk about you in social media. The people in the middle shrug their shoulders and won&#8217;t mention you either way.</p>
<p>Two lessons from this chart:</p>
<ol>
<li>Stop marketing to people on the right side of this bell curve. They might deliver short-term cash flow but hurt your business in the long run.</li>
<li>Moving the curve a little bit to the left will increase the number of positive conversations and grow your business through word-of-mouth.</li>
</ol>

<p>This is the story about the &#8216;Mystery Man&#8217; campaign we ran on behalf of the Dallas Convention &amp; Visitors Bureau last week. It&#8217;s a story of the power of social media, passionate communities and bringing people together. We knew it was a great idea but the results exceeded our wildest imagination.</p>
<p><strong>Background</strong></p>
<p>Social Media is about sharing and bringing people together. When the Dallas CVB asked us to design a campaign around Super Bowl XLV we thought &#8216;Why not use social media to get people talking to each other about Dallas?&#8217;.</p>
<p>At <a href="http://thinksocialmedia.com/"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/thinksocialmedia.com/?referer=');">Think! Social Media</a>, we work with the concept of passionate communities. These are groups of people connected through a shared passion. Engage a passionate community in the right way by offering something remarkable, and they will do the marketing for you through word-of-mouth.</p>
<p><strong>The Big Idea</strong></p>
<p>Needless to say, every NFL team has an extremely passionate community&#8230; and offering a chance to win Super Bowl tickets is pretty remarkable. Remarkable enough get people out into the street talking to each other.</p>
<p>We decided to send a Mystery Man to each city of the teams who made it to the Super Bowl. The first person to find the Mystery Man and tell him the secret phrase,  &#8216;Have you been to Dallas lately?&#8217; would instantly win tickets to the big game, 4 nights accommodation, tickets to the NFL experience and some cash towards travel.</p>
<p><strong>The Process</strong></p>
<p>We researched NFL and travel/lifestyle bloggers in each city and asked them if they would like to participate.  As &#8220;Exclusive Bloggers&#8221;, their role would be to share daily clues about the location of the Mystery Man.  We were careful in choosing bloggers that have strong social media presences and very engaged readers.  We chose 5 in Green Bay and 4 in Pittsburgh.  Their role was crucial in tapping into the existing communities and raising awareness about the campaign.</p>
<p><a rel="attachment wp-att-2023" href="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/?attachment_id=2023"><img title="Dallas_Clue" src="http://thinksocialm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Dallas_Clue.jpg" alt="" width="432" height="288" /></a></p>
<p>The clues tied in to imagery and facts about attractions in Dallas and became increasingly specific as the weekend went on.   By printing the clues on photos they were easy to share through Twitter, and were eye-catching on the blogs and Facebook.</p>
<p>The secret password could only be revealed by &#8216;liking&#8217; the <a href="http://www.facebook.com/visitdallas"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.facebook.com/visitdallas?referer=');">Visit Dallas</a> Facebook Fan Page.  A campaign Twitter account (<a href="http://twitter.com/DallasSBHunt"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/twitter.com/DallasSBHunt?referer=');">@DallasSBHunt</a>) was created to coordinate all activities, answer questions and share the latest updates.  In addition two hashtags (#SBHuntGB and #SBHuntPGH) were introduced to facilitate discussion around the contest.</p>
<p><strong>Results</strong></p>
<p><em>Sunday</em></p>
<p>The conference finals were played on Sunday January 23. We were prepared for each of the 4 cities. At the end of Sunday we knew the contest would run in Green Bay and Pittsburgh.</p>
<p><em>Monday</em></p>
<p>We finalized the details of the contest and sent out materials to the bloggers so they could prepare their first blog posts announcing the contest.  At this time we activated the contest tab on the Visit Dallas fan page which only had 600 fans.</p>
<p><em>Tuesday</em></p>
<p>By noon, the bloggers in each city had announced the contest.</p>
<p>Green Bay: <a href="http://www.totalpackers.com/2011/01/25/heres-your-chance-to-win-super-bowl-tickets/"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.totalpackers.com/2011/01/25/heres-your-chance-to-win-super-bowl-tickets/?referer=');">Total Packers</a>, <a href="http://brentfavre.com/2011/01/25/win-a-trip-to-the-super-bowl-yes-the-real-one-in-dallas/"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/brentfavre.com/2011/01/25/win-a-trip-to-the-super-bowl-yes-the-real-one-in-dallas/?referer=');">Brent Farvre</a>, <a href="http://www.packersgab.com/2011/01/28/win-a-super-bowl-package-in-the-dallas-superbowl-hunt-giveaway-2/"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.packersgab.com/2011/01/28/win-a-super-bowl-package-in-the-dallas-superbowl-hunt-giveaway-2/?referer=');">Packers Club</a>, <a href="http://purplepantsgreenjersey.com/2011/01/25/anybody-want-free-super-bowl-tickets/"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/purplepantsgreenjersey.com/2011/01/25/anybody-want-free-super-bowl-tickets/?referer=');">Purple Pants Green Jersey</a>,<a href="http://www.jerseyal.com/GBP/2011/01/25/read-this-blog-and-you-could-win-2-tickets-to-the-super-bowl-for-real/"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.jerseyal.com/GBP/2011/01/25/read-this-blog-and-you-could-win-2-tickets-to-the-super-bowl-for-real/?referer=');"> All Green Bay Packers</a></p>
<p>Pittsburgh: <a href="http://iheartpgh.com/2011/01/26/find-the-mystery-man-you-could-be-headed-to-dallas-to-watch-the-super-bowl/"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/iheartpgh.com/2011/01/26/find-the-mystery-man-you-could-be-headed-to-dallas-to-watch-the-super-bowl/?referer=');">IheartPGH</a>, <a href="http://www.steelersgab.com/2011/01/25/win-a-super-bowl-package-in-the-dallas-superbowl-hunt-giveaway/"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.steelersgab.com/2011/01/25/win-a-super-bowl-package-in-the-dallas-superbowl-hunt-giveaway/?referer=');">Steelers Gab</a>, <a href="http://psamp.com/2011-articles/january/do-you-want-free-super-bowl-tickets.html"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/psamp.com/2011-articles/january/do-you-want-free-super-bowl-tickets.html?referer=');">Pittsburgh Sports and Mini Ponies</a></p>
<p>Slowly the word started to spread.  At the end of Tuesday, the fanpage had grown to over 1,000 fans and the followers of the campaign Twitter account began to grow.</p>
<p><em>Wednesday/Thursday</em></p>
<p>We continued to build awareness over the next few days. By carefully listening in on Twitter, tapping in to relevant communites and joining the conversations where appropriate we were able to rapidly spread word of the contest. By Thursday, traditional media had gotten wind of what we were up to and a few stations began to report on the contest on the the nightly news.  By the end of Thursday over 3000 people had liked the Visit Dallas page.</p>
<p><a rel="attachment wp-att-2033" href="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/?attachment_id=2033"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-2033" title="Friday_Media" src="http://thinksocialm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Friday_Media-450x114.png" alt="" width="450" height="114" /></a></p>
<p><em>Friday</em></p>
<p>At 9am the Exclusive Bloggers announced their first clues and the contest began.  We quickly learned that we had struck gold in both cities. The streets were full of people searching for our Mystery Man, many tweeting as they went and following along on Facebook.  By Friday @DallasSBHunt was trending in both Pittsburgh and Green Bay.</p>
<p><a rel="attachment wp-att-2089" href="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/?attachment_id=2089"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-2089" title="Trendsmap" src="http://thinksocialm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Trendsmap2-450x363.png" alt="" width="450" height="363" /></a></p>
<p>Best of all, two whole cities were out on the streets talking to each other about Dallas.</p>
<p><a rel="attachment wp-att-2090" href="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/?attachment_id=2090"><img title="Best boss comment" src="http://thinksocialm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Best-boss-comment-450x203.png" alt="" width="450" height="203" /></a></p>
<p><a rel="attachment wp-att-2091" href="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/?attachment_id=2091"><img title="Dallas all over PGH" src="http://thinksocialm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Dallas-all-over-PGH-450x206.png" alt="" width="450" height="206" /></a></p>
<p><a rel="attachment wp-att-2092" href="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/?attachment_id=2092"><img title="I have why" src="http://thinksocialm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/I-have-why.png" alt="" width="437" height="143" /></a></p>
<p>That night, the hunt for the Dallas Mystery Man was the headline news on all the local stations (<a href="http://www.wtae.com/video/26656301/detail.html"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.wtae.com/video/26656301/detail.html?referer=');">this is my favourite</a>). The Visit Dallas Fan Page had grown to 8,000 fans and the campaign Twitter account had well over 1500 followers.</p>
<p><em>Saturday</em></p>
<p>We were lucky that Friday&#8217;s clues had been vague enough for our Mystery Men to keep from getting caught, but by Saturday the amount of people on the street made it significantly more difficult to make it through the city unnoticed.</p>
<p>Just after noon our Mystery Man in Green Bay was found and not long after our man in Pittsburgh was caught as well.</p>
<p>The hunt was over, but the ride wasn&#8217;t. The winners were invited on news shows (<a href="http://www.wpxi.com/video/26663971/index.html"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.wpxi.com/video/26663971/index.html?referer=');">1</a>, <a href="http://pittsburgh.cbslocal.com/2011/01/29/want-super-bowl-tickets-find-the-mystery-man/"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/pittsburgh.cbslocal.com/2011/01/29/want-super-bowl-tickets-find-the-mystery-man/?referer=');">2</a>, <a href="http://www.fox11online.com/dpp/news/local-homeless-couple-super-bowl-bound-"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.fox11online.com/dpp/news/local-homeless-couple-super-bowl-bound-?referer=');">3</a>, <a href="http://www.wbay.com/Global/story.asp?S=13933019"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.wbay.com/Global/story.asp?S=13933019&amp;referer=');">4</a>, <a href="http://www.14wfie.com/story/13936516/homeless-couple-wins-tickets-to-super-bowl"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.14wfie.com/story/13936516/homeless-couple-wins-tickets-to-super-bowl?referer=');">5</a>) and countless blogs, websites, radio stations and news papers were reporting on the contest and its winners.</p>
<p><a rel="attachment wp-att-2024" href="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/?attachment_id=2024"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-2024" title="saturday" src="http://thinksocialm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/saturday-450x228.png" alt="" width="450" height="228" /></a></p>
<p><em>Sunday and beyond</em></p>
<p>The winners in Green Bay turned out to be a couple who are homeless and live in a local shelter. They were invited on Fox 11&#8242;s <a href="http://www.fox11online.com/dpp/news/local-homeless-couple-super-bowl-bound-#"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.fox11online.com/dpp/news/local-homeless-couple-super-bowl-bound-?referer=');">morning show</a> to tell their story.  Shortly thereafter <a href="http://www.facebook.com/ThinkSocialMedia/posts/188827681140838" target="_blank" onclick="pageTracker._trackPageview('/outgoing/www.facebook.com/ThinkSocialMedia/posts/188827681140838?referer=');">CNN picked up the story</a> and we had reports from our contacts all over North America (even as far as Australia) who saw the campaign on the news.</p>
<p><a rel="attachment wp-att-2052" href="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/?attachment_id=2052"><img class="aligncenter size-medium wp-image-2052" title="Screen shot 2011-01-31 at 1.08.05 PM" src="http://thinksocialmedia.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/01/Screen-shot-2011-01-31-at-1.08.05-PM-450x227.png" alt="" width="450" height="227" /></a></p>
<p><strong>The Results</strong></p>
<p>We definitely succeeded in getting people talking about Dallas. We also proved that when you run a Social Media campaign within passionate communities, you don&#8217;t need a big media budget.  And, if the community is passionate enough, you&#8217;ll even make it on the news.</p>
<p>We grew the Visit Dallas Fan Page by almost 10,000 fans in three days. The fanpage received about 100,000 pageviews and generated over 500,000 news feed impressions.</p>
<p>But what we&#8217;re most proud of is the incredible positive reaction from the people in Green Bay and Pittsburgh. We received many messages from individuals telling Dallas how much they enjoyed the weekend.</p>

<p>One of the things I&#8217;m looking at is what DMO&#8217;s are doing to incorporate real time information. This is a trend DMO&#8217;s can&#8217;t ignore. Brochureware websites are no longer acceptable and consumers expect content that is timely as well.</p>
<p>Florida has created a <em>Florida Live</em> section on their website. The page includes their Twitter feed, Flickr photo&#8217;s, YouTube videos etc. It also includes a Google Map with the Twitter feeds from local DMO&#8217;s, live webcams, YouTube videos and Fishing Reports.</p>
<p><img title="Florida Fishing Map" src="http://www.wilhelmus.ca/wp-content/uploads/Screen-shot-2010-12-29-at-4.07.12-PM-450x361.png" alt="" width="450" height="361" /></p>
<p>The fishing reports are very cool. Every day the captains call in from their boats to give an update of the fishing conditions of their area. Users can listen to each captain reporting on the conditions.</p>
<p>Incorporating expert content from industry members or residents is something I&#8217;ve been pitching for a long time now. Most DMO&#8217;s do this with expert bloggers (some better than others). This is a very creative idea to make it timely, relevant and credible.</p>
